An antique mahjong game dating to 1925, featuring bone and shell tiles. The set reflects early 20th‑century craftsmanship, with bone tiles carrying engraved or painted pips and shell accents that add a subtle translucence. Built for live play or display, the pieces embody a restrained design language of the era and offer tactile appeal and historical context for collectors and enthusiasts of traditional gaming artifacts.
SpecificationsVisual characteristics include pale bone tiles with carved or painted pips and shell inlays that add subtle contrast. Tile faces are uniform in size with squared‑off edges, reflecting traditional Mahjong set proportions from the period. The overall aesthetic is restrained, with a muted palette and hand‑finished edges that indicate crafted production typical of early 20th‑century sets.
